Greenville (Texas) Herald Banner, Sat, 3 Apr 1982, page A2, Deaths, Caldwell

Mary Elizabeth Bellah Caldwell, 90, of Greenville, died Friday at a local nursing home.

Funeral service will be Sunday at 2 p.m. at Coker-Mathews Funeral Chapel with the Rev. Laddie Hixon officiating. Burial will be at Forest Park Cemetery.

Born Jan. 21, 1892, in Cumby, Mrs. Caldwell was the daughter of Jim and Laura Lane Akins. She married Ed Bellah Nov. 21, 1909. He preceded her in death June 30, 1945. She married A.L. Caldwell in January 1951. He preceded her in death March 3, 1969. Mrs. Caldwell was a member of Donelton Baptist Church.

Surviving are her son, Luther Bellah of Dallas; daughters, Frances Strickland of Fort Worth and Beulah Patterson of Greenville; stepchildren, Hallie Mae Boykin and Elmer Caldwell, both of Greenville, Inez Akins of Dallas, Rosie Lee Smith of Grapevine and Dwayne Caldwell of Amarillo; 13 grandchildren; 31 great-grandchildren and eight great-great-grandchildren.

She was preceded in death by her sons, Joe Bellah and J.C. Bellah.

Coker-Mathews Funeral Home is in charge of arrangements.
